Abstract

The invention discloses a kind of automobile self-locking nuts, including screw head, first protrusive board, second protrusive board and stud, the screw head, first protrusive board, perforation is equipped with first through hole in second protrusive board and stud, internal screw thread is equipped in the first through hole, the screw head bottom surface is equipped with the second through-hole, the top surface of the screw head is equipped with several first slittings, the top surface of first protrusive board is equipped with several second slittings, the top surface of the third protrusive board is cut equipped with several thirds, the side wall of the stud is equipped with several prickers, so that nut is after being tapped into substrate, first slitting, second slitting, third slitting and pricker can be embedded in different angle and depth in the surface and preset holes of substrate, increase the contact area of nut and substrate, improve the frictional force of nut and substrate, to effectively prevent nut transfer when in use, pass through The case where non-slip texture on two protrusive board surfaces further prevents nut to have skidded.

Description

A kind of automobile self-locking nut
[technical field]
The present invention relates to the technical field of nut, especially a kind of technical field of automobile self-locking nut.
[background technique]
Nut can be all used when currently, many components being installed on automobile, but since common nut is without self-locking and anti- Skidding function can be loosened because being vibrated, and will appear nut when the nut of loosening is used cooperatively with bolt and substrate skids The case where rotation or even nut fall off seriously affects firmness of the connection, promotes security risk.Therefore in view of the above-mentioned problems, proposing A kind of automobile self-locking nut.
[summary of the invention]
The object of the invention is to solve the problems of the prior art, proposes a kind of automobile self-locking nut, can pass through The first protrusive board and the first slitting are fixed in screw head, the second protrusive board and the second slitting are fixed on the first protrusive board, in the second protrusive board Upper fixing belt has the stud and third slitting of pricker so that nut is after being tapped into substrate, the first slitting, the second slitting, Third slitting and pricker can be embedded in different angle and depth in the surface and preset holes of substrate, increase contact of the nut with substrate Area, improves the frictional force of nut and substrate, to effectively prevent nut transfer when in use, passes through the anti-of the second protrusive board surface The case where sliding lines further prevents nut to have skidded.
To achieve the above object, the invention proposes a kind of automobile self-locking nuts, including screw head, the first protrusive board, second Protrusive board and stud, the interior perforation of the screw head, the first protrusive board, the second protrusive board and stud are equipped with first through hole, the first through hole Interior to be equipped with internal screw thread, the screw head bottom surface is equipped with the second through-hole, and the top surface of the screw head is equipped with several first slittings, institute The top surface for stating the first protrusive board is equipped with several second slittings, and the top surface of the third protrusive board is cut equipped with several thirds, described The side wall of stud is equipped with several prickers.
Preferably, the first through hole is connected with the second through-hole.
Preferably, the diameter of second through-hole is greater than the diameter of first through hole, the edge of second through-hole is equipped with Curved flanges.
Preferably, first protrusive board is located at the top surface center of screw head, the diameter of first protrusive board is less than screw head Diameter, second protrusive board be located at the first protrusive board top surface center, the diameter of second protrusive board is less than the first protrusive board Diameter, the stud are located at the top surface center of the second protrusive board, the diameter of the diameter of the stud less than the second protrusive board.
Preferably, it is described first slitting height it is consistent with the height of the first protrusive board, it is described second slitting height and The height of second protrusive board is consistent.
Preferably, the angle for the position distribution that first slitting, the second slitting and third are cut mutually staggers.
Preferably, second protrusive board top surface is in addition to being additionally provided with non-slip texture at third slitting.
Preferably, the screw head, the first protrusive board, the second protrusive board and stud are structure as a whole.
Beneficial effects of the present invention: the present invention in screw head by fixing the first protrusive board and the first slitting, in the first protrusive board On fix the second protrusive board and second slitting, on the second protrusive board fixing belt have pricker stud and third slitting so that nut exists After being tapped into substrate, the first slitting, the second slitting, third slitting and pricker can be embedded in the surface and preset holes of substrate Different angle and depth increase the contact area of nut and substrate, the frictional force of nut and substrate are improved, to effectively prevent spiral shell Female transfer when in use, the case where further preventing nut to have skidded by the non-slip texture on the second protrusive board surface.
Feature and advantage of the invention will be described in detail by embodiment combination attached drawing.
[Detailed description of the invention]
Fig. 1 is a kind of schematic perspective view of automobile self-locking nut of the present invention;
Fig. 2 is a kind of top view of automobile self-locking nut of the present invention;
Fig. 3 is a kind of bottom view of automobile self-locking nut of the present invention.
In figure: 1- screw head, the slitting of 11- first, the second through-hole of 12-, 121- curved flanges, the first protrusive board of 2-, 21- second are cut Item, the second protrusive board of 3-, 31- third slitting, 32- non-slip texture, 4- stud, 41- pricker, 5- first through hole and 51- internal screw thread.
[specific embodiment]
Refering to fig. 1, Fig. 2 and Fig. 3, a kind of automobile self-locking nut of the present invention, including screw head 1, the first protrusive board 2, second are convex Plate 3 and stud 4, interior penetrate through of the screw head 1, the first protrusive board 2, the second protrusive board 3 and stud 4 are equipped with first through hole 5, and described first Internal screw thread 51 is equipped in through-hole 5,1 bottom surface of screw head is equipped with the second through-hole 12, and the top surface of the screw head 1 is equipped with several First slitting 11, the top surface of first protrusive board 2 are equipped with several second slittings 21, and the top surface of the third protrusive board 3 is equipped with Several third slittings 31, the side wall of the stud 4 are equipped with several prickers 41, and the first through hole 5 is connected with the second through-hole 12 Logical, the diameter of second through-hole 12 is greater than the diameter of first through hole 5, and the edge of second through-hole 12 is equipped with curved flanges 121, first protrusive board 2 is located at the top surface center of screw head 1, and the diameter of first protrusive board 2 is less than the diameter of screw head 1, institute The second protrusive board 3 stated is located at the top surface center of the first protrusive board 2, the diameter of second protrusive board 3 less than the first protrusive board 2 diameter, The stud 4 is located at the top surface center of the second protrusive board 3, the diameter of the stud 4 less than the second protrusive board 3 diameter, described the The height of one slitting 11 is consistent with the height of the first protrusive board 2, the height of second slitting 21 and the height one of the second protrusive board 3 It causes, the angle of the position distribution of 11, second slitting 21 of the first slitting and third slitting 31 mutually staggers, second protrusive board In addition to being additionally provided with non-slip texture 32 at third slitting 31, the screw head 1, the first protrusive board 2, the second protrusive board 3 and stud 4 are for 3 top surfaces Integral structure.
The course of work of the present invention:
A kind of automobile self-locking nut of the present invention during the work time, makes a call to a preset holes, merging is originally on substrate first A kind of automobile self-locking nut is invented, taps the bottom surface of screw head 1 until the second protrusive board 3 and the first protrusive board 2 are completely embedded into substrate Surface.
The present invention fixes the second protrusive board and the by fixing the first protrusive board and the first slitting in screw head on the first protrusive board Two slittings, fixing belt has the stud and third slitting of pricker on the second protrusive board, so that nut is after being tapped into substrate, the One slitting, the second slitting, third slitting and pricker can be embedded in different angle and depth in the surface and preset holes of substrate, increase The contact area of nut and substrate, the frictional force for improving nut and substrate pass through to effectively prevent nut transfer when in use The case where non-slip texture on the second protrusive board surface further prevents nut to have skidded.
